Dynamics crm Dynamics CRM插件电子邮件-Sql加密对称密钥错误

Dynamics crm Dynamics CRM插件电子邮件-Sql加密对称密钥错误,dynamics-crm,microsoft-dynamics,dynamics-crm-2016,dynamics-365,Dynamics Crm,Microsoft Dynamics,Dynamics Crm 2016,Dynamics 365,当我尝试在插件中发送电子邮件时,我遇到了某种加密错误(操作)。我有两个相同的环境。它在dev中工作,但当我将其部署到UAT环境中时,我在工作流中得到以下错误,当操作尝试创建/发送电子邮件时,该工作流会触发该操作。这两种环境都不是HTTPS。很多在线帖子都说要进入设置->数据管理->数据加密,但该框不会打开,因为它不是HTTPS 无法打开Sql加密对称密钥,因为对称密钥 配置数据库中不存在密码 如果有人有什么建议那就太棒了。 谢谢,在CRM中发送电子邮件需要启用数据加密,如果您检查开发环境,我相信

当我尝试在插件中发送电子邮件时,我遇到了某种加密错误(操作)。我有两个相同的环境。它在dev中工作,但当我将其部署到UAT环境中时,我在工作流中得到以下错误,当操作尝试创建/发送电子邮件时,该工作流会触发该操作。这两种环境都不是HTTPS。很多在线帖子都说要进入设置->数据管理->数据加密,但该框不会打开,因为它不是HTTPS

无法打开Sql加密对称密钥,因为对称密钥 配置数据库中不存在密码

如果有人有什么建议那就太棒了。
谢谢,

在CRM中发送电子邮件需要启用数据加密,如果您检查
开发
环境,我相信
数据加密
将处于活动状态(转到设置->数据管理–>数据加密)如下图所示,这就是为什么您的
插件在
dev
环境中运行良好的原因

您需要在UAT环境中启用数据加密。

请尝试以下步骤:

1.禁用SSL检查(非HTTPS部署-如果使用HTTPS) 部署,跳过此步骤)

2。为MSCRM\u配置数据库运行以下SQL

      UPDATE [MSCRM_CONFIG].[dbo].[DeploymentProperties]
      SET [BitColumn]=1
      WHERE ColumnName='DisableSSLCheckForEncryption'
3.进入设置->数据管理->数据加密

4.输入任何加密密钥,可以是任何密钥,然后单击“激活”。

请在此处阅读有关数据加密和加密密钥的更多信息:


在CRM中发送电子邮件需要启用数据加密,如果您检查
开发
环境,我相信
数据加密
将处于活动状态(转到设置->数据管理–>数据加密)如下图所示,这就是为什么您的
插件在
dev
环境中运行良好的原因

您需要在UAT环境中启用数据加密。

请尝试以下步骤:

1.禁用SSL检查(非HTTPS部署-如果使用HTTPS) 部署,跳过此步骤)

2。为MSCRM\u配置数据库运行以下SQL

      UPDATE [MSCRM_CONFIG].[dbo].[DeploymentProperties]
      SET [BitColumn]=1
      WHERE ColumnName='DisableSSLCheckForEncryption'
3.进入设置->数据管理->数据加密

4.输入任何加密密钥,可以是任何密钥,然后单击“激活”。

请在此处阅读有关数据加密和加密密钥的更多信息: